Arcata Lantern Floating Ceremony

A memorial for all those effected by the WWII bombings of Hiroshima and Nagasaki, to bring awareness to the dangers of nuclear proliferation, and to advocate for peace and environmental sustainability. 9am – 1:30pm - Lantern Making at the Arcata Farmer’s Market - Tables will be set up and there will be supplies. 7pm - 7:30pm - People will gather at the Arcata Marsh & Wildlife Sanctuary by Klopp Lake at the end of South I Street. Rick Kruze will be playing the shakuhachi flute as people arrive. Sofia Pereira Ornelas will be presiding. The Raging Grannies will be singing songs. 8:40 - Lantern Floating.
